Things to Do in Nashville, Tennessee with Family

Nashville, Tennessee, often called “Music City,” offers a vibrant mix of attractions that cater to families. Beyond the honky-tonks, you’ll find museums, parks, and kid-friendly activities that make for a memorable vacation.

Explore the Country Music Hall of Fame and Museum

No trip to Nashville is complete without diving into its musical heritage. The Country Music Hall of Fame and Museum is a fantastic starting point. Interactive exhibits, historical artifacts, and educational programs bring the story of country music to life for all ages. Check the schedule for family-friendly concerts or workshops.

Visit the Nashville Zoo

The Nashville Zoo at Grassmere is a popular destination for families. Home to a diverse collection of animals from around the world, the zoo offers engaging exhibits and activities. Kids will love the Jungle Gym playground, the petting zoo, and the daily animal shows. It’s a great way to spend a day outdoors and learn about wildlife conservation.

Enjoy Centennial Park and the Parthenon

Centennial Park is a sprawling green space perfect for a picnic, a leisurely stroll, or some outdoor games. The park’s centerpiece is a full-scale replica of the Parthenon, offering a glimpse into ancient Greek architecture. The Parthenon also houses an art museum with a collection of American paintings.

Take a Riverboat Cruise

A riverboat cruise on the Cumberland River provides a unique perspective of Nashville’s skyline. Several companies offer daytime and evening cruises with live music, dining, and sightseeing. It’s a relaxing way to learn about the city’s history and enjoy the scenic views.

Discover Adventure Science Center

The Adventure Science Center is an interactive museum designed to spark curiosity and learning in children of all ages. Exhibits cover a wide range of topics, from space exploration to the human body. The museum features a planetarium and offers hands-on activities that make science fun and engaging.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are some free things to do in Nashville with kids?

Centennial Park, including the Parthenon (exterior views), is free. Many parks and green spaces offer free activities. Check for free concerts or events happening during your visit.

Is Nashville a good city for families?

Yes, Nashville offers a variety of attractions that cater to families, including museums, parks, and kid-friendly activities.

What is the best time of year to visit Nashville with family?

Spring (April-May) and fall (September-October) offer pleasant weather and fewer crowds compared to the summer months.

How much does it cost to visit the Country Music Hall of Fame?

Ticket prices vary, but expect to pay around $28-$30 per adult and less for children and seniors. Check the museum’s website for current pricing and discounts.

Are there any good day trips from Nashville for families?

Franklin, TN, is a charming historic town located a short drive south of Nashville and has family-friendly attractions.
